Power, Interest and Psychology: Elements of a Social Materialist Understanding of Distress
Author: David Smail<br />File Type: epub<br />The central argument of this book is that human conduct, and in particular psychological and emotional distress, cannot be understood by an analysis of individual will, intention or cognition. Conventional therapeutic psychology suggests that we are essentially self-creating and able (with a little help from a therapist) to heal ourselves of the emotional ills that beset us. This kind of view reflects the wishful thinking and make-believe that are necessary for the success of modern consumer capitalism, but it does not reflect the way things are. The alternative set out here, explains how our experience of ourselves as well as much of our conduct is accounted for in terms of the social operation of power and interest. A framework is established for making sense of our emotional distress as the outcome of environmental pressures.
